HOPE CRISIS CENTRE, SKOPJE

Total budget:  MKD 3,963,600

Timeframe: 24 months

SHORT DESCRIPTION OF the ORGANIZATION

Crisis Centre “Hope” is an association that has 18 years of experience in providing direct support to the domestic violence victims, as well as prevention work in order to end the circle of violence, the integrated approach in our work is seen in the support of the domestic violence victims via the SOS help lines, sheltering in a period of 24-48 hours and emotional strengthening and free legal aid, as well as the figure of more than 30 implemented prevention projects.

  • Crisis counselling and referrals via the SOS help lines (National SOS line 15-315 and two Confidence Phones 02/3 175-516, 02/3 173-424).
  • Emotional strengthening and initial legal aid by educating the domestic violence victims
  • Sheltering, providing secure and safe temporary shelter of 24-48 hours with a sheltering capacity of 5-7 victims of domestic violence;
  • Prevention domestic violence and violence against women programme.

CONSTITUENTS

Women and children, victims of domestic violence.

RESULTS

  • Increased cooperation with the business sector;
  • Increased practice of collection of donations from individuals;
  • Secured financial aid from national and local institutions;
  • Secured material and programme aid from national and/or local institutions;
  • Secured assistance to victims of domestic violence by using an integrated model;
  • Strengthened prevention from domestic violence.
